#17fe6d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17fe6d is composed of 9% red, 99.6%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 142.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 54.3%. #17fe6d color hex could be obtained by blending #2effda with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

Shades and Tints of #17fe6d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#17fe6d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#839288 is the less saturated color, while #17fe6d is the most saturated one.
